Will the Brewers’ Bats Come Alive Against Yamamoto?

The spotlight now turns to the Dodgers’ starting pitcher for Game 2, Yoshinobu Yamamoto, who boasts an impressive regular-season ERA of 2.49. The Brewers’ offense, which is not known for overpowering hitting, will need to find their rhythm against Yamamoto, especially after struggling against Snell in the previous game. TBS analyst Ron Darling aptly pointed out that “a 3-2 count is a rally” against Snell, indicating how challenging it was for the Brewers to make adjustments at the plate.

However, the Brewers previously knocked Yamamoto out early in a July game thanks to Andrew Vaughn’s powerful start. This history could provide confidence as Milwaukee looks to capitalize on their past success against him.

Can Roki Sasaki Recover?

The Dodgers find themselves in a precarious situation regarding their bullpen depth after Roki Sasaki’s shaky Game 1 performance. As a pivotal player in their pitching staff strategy, Sasaki was uncharacteristically ineffective, walking two batters and allowing a double before being replaced. His inconsistency adds pressure to the Dodgers as they rely heavily on their starters and him to close out tight games. Manager Dave Roberts’ confidence in Sasaki will be tested in Game 2; a bouncing back is essential for Los Angeles’ chances.
